In this episode of the Dental Code Advisor Podcast, join Dr. Greg Grobmyer as he interviews the “A/R Ninja” himself, Andy Cleveland. Learn about recent changes to laws that affect the way your dental office should go about handling accounts receivable and collections.

Andy Grover Cleveland is the Collections Ninja helps with collections and accounts receivable for dental offices.
